Po600 code - comm link

Hi,I'm trying to resolve a P0600 code on my 98 maxima. The EC Manual say to check for continuity between terminals on ECM and TCM. The terminal pairs are (ECM - TCM) 65-47, 66-38, 73-10, 74-11 and 77-12. I'm not getting continuity between and of the pairs. I have my battery disconnected although the EC Manual is asking to turn the ignition OFF only. I find it strange that continuity doesn't exist between any of the terminal pairs. Am I doing something wrong. Any help would be appreciated. Thanks in advance.
